#4 The Golf Drill Guru 2009-08-23 16:44 Hey Ben,

The best measurement would be to ensure that your arms are hanging freely from your shoulders. As long as you are not forcibly reaching, or forcing your hands close to your body you should find a good position. Ideally, with a proper setup position, your arms should hang nearly straight down from your shoulders. From this position, simply grip a club, where it lies on the grass is how far the ball should be from your stance. I hope that helps!

#2 The Golf Drill Guru 2009-08-12 17:22 Hi Ben, thanks for uploading your swing!

John already made some valid comments, but I have some additional feedback I'd like to share with you. Yes, as John said, you're too close to the ball, this is causing you to be hunched over. You can see it quite clearly when you setup, your spine is curved and not straight. If you stand further away from the ball, and focus on maintaining a consistent spine angle throughout your swing, I think a lot of your problems will disappear.

Specifically, your inside move on the takeaway, and your slight over-the-top move.

#1 John B 2009-08-12 07:19 Hey Benzilla - looks to me like your standing too close to the ball… as I know this can cause a slice. Also your backswing is a inside on your take back that seems to cause you to come over the top a bit on the downswing. Which would likely make your slice worse. Quote
